Research The Cost Before You Buy
Before you decide to purchase a vehicle, do some research. Look up what it costs to get the oil changed on that particular car or truck. It’s just a fact that it’s far more expensive to get an oil change on a Mercedes than on a Honda Accord. Different parts and services have different costs for different vehicles.
You Need To Be Able To Afford Maintenance
If you’ve been following us for a while you know that we’re big on keeping up with your maintenance! It’s so easy to get into a vehicle that is right at the top of your price point for a monthly payment or the total price, and not think about the fact that you’re going to need even more money for maintenance. Many people stretch themselves to buy the car, only to find that they don’t really have the money for upkeep!
We recommend that you do your research, or talk to your dealer or talk to us about how much it costs to maintain the different cars you’re considering. Again, we’re not trying to encourage you to buy cheaper cars, and we’re not knocking expensive cars. We just want you to know what you’re getting into so that you can be prepared. Think of it as being a lot like buying a house. You don’t want to spend all your money on the house and not be able to furnish it! You don’t want to buy a new car only to find out that you can’t afford to keep gas in it or manage the recommended maintenance items.
